The Hansa, Line,

The Hansa Line, which is‡ working in the Far East anderk an agreement with the Hamburg Amerika Linio, has declared dividend of 15 per cent. for last year, as compared with 10 port gent, for 1010. The gross surplus," including M. 44,400 brought for ward, amounted to. M. 6,233,840, as compared with M. 4,362,895
